Making the psychosocial work environment concrete and sustainable

Many workplaces wish to strengthen their psychosocial work environment but are unsure where to begin, how to measure progress, or how to anchor the effort in a busy everyday context. Others may have tried individual initiatives, only to find that they did not become embedded in the organisational culture.

MentiMove is an online solution that makes it simple to work with the psychosocial work environment in a structured and engaging way — without losing overview. MentiMove brings together learning, evaluation, and implementation in one platform that automatically connects group programmes, reflection exercises, and temperature checks with practical tools for everyday use.

It has been developed by the Institute for Strain Psychology and is based on evidence, practical experience, and usability. It is designed to support leadership, HR, and employees alike — and to help sustain what works when everyday demands increase again.
